I'm not too versed in the intricacies of Windows, but I don't think that's the case on Linux at least.

There's a difference between telling the processes to "fuck off" (by using umount -f) and actually yanking the drive.

umount -f will at least flush the caches to drive, including all filesystem metadata and journaling, while just yanking the drive off will definitely not, and if you're unlucky you can ruin the FS (especially if it's not a journaling one). I've lost data like that before, been using umount -f ever since.
